Savanna Taylor Email
Director Production and Creative Technology | Office Hiring Manager . Flash Photography
Dallas, TX
LocationPrimary Email
How to contact Savanna Taylor
Join and see Savanna's contact info for free!Current Roles
Employees:
118Revenue:
$1.7MAbout
Flash Photography Address
8150 N Central ExpyDallas, TX
United States
